site stats

Bubble sort facts

WebNov 24, 2024 · Bubble Sort in C. Sorting is the process of arranging the data in some logical order. Bubble sort is an algorithm to sort various linear data structures. The …

algorithm - What is a bubble sort good for? - Stack …

WebJun 13, 2024 · Python Program for Bubble Sort. 6. C++ Program for Recursive Bubble Sort. 7. Java Program for Recursive Bubble Sort. 8. C program for Time Complexity plot of Bubble, Insertion and Selection Sort using Gnuplot. 9. … WebThere are a few facts about Bubble Sort, which everyone should know before implementing it: A bubble sort is often considered as a not good efficient sorting method. As it has to exchange the items until its... This … homedics 5 motor full body massage mat https://youin-ele.com

Explanation of Bubble sort With Sample Code - EduCBA

WebBub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ing the current element with the one after it, swapping their values if needed. These passes through the list are repeated until no swaps had to be performed during a pass, meaning that the list has … WebMar 31, 2024 · Time Complexity: O(N 2) Auxiliary Space: O(1) Worst Case Analysis for Bubble Sort: The worst-case condition for bubble sort occurs when elements of the array are arranged in decreasing order. In the worst case, the total number of iterations or … Selection Sort, Bubble Sort, Insertion Sort, Merge Sort, Heap Sort, QuickSort, … Insertion sort is a simple sorting algorithm that works similar to the way you sort … Selection sort is a simple and efficient sorting algorithm that works by … WebMay 1, 2012 · It's a sort of "brute force" sort but it's not bubble sort. Here's an example of a generic bubble sort. It uses an arbitrary comparer, but lets you omit it in which case the default comparer is used for the relevant type. It will sort any (non-readonly) implementation of IList, which includes arrays. Read the above link (to Wikipedia) to get ... homedics 5 motor massage mat

Bubble Sort - javatpoint

Category:The Quadratic Sorting Algorithms: An Overview of Bubble

Tags:Bubble sort facts

Bubble sort facts

Download Free New Perspectives Excel Tutorial 12 Case 2

WebShell short is an improved and efficient version of Insertion Sort rather while compared with other Sorting Techniques like Merge Sort , Bubble Sort and Selection Sort which we have already discussed earlier. In this algorithm we sort the pair of elements that are far apart by gap h. The process is repeated by reducing h until it becomes 1. WebBubble sort is a simple, inefficient sorting algorithm used to sort lists. It is generally one of the first algorithms taught in computer science courses because it is a good algorithm to learn to build intuition about sorting. …

Bubble sort facts

Did you know?

WebDec 7, 2024 · Surely only something like bubble sort is in-place? 3. Rigorous Proof of Insertion Sort. 2. Proving correctness of an iterative Fibonacci algorithm. 1. Is the outer … WebTo show that Bubble-Sort is correct, we must show that the final array A’ is a permutation (reordering) of the original array A such that A’[1] ≤ A’[2] ≤ … ≤ A’[n]. At all times, the …

WebThere exist strictly better algorithms than bubble sort (i.e., faster, lower-power, same-space, and simpler), the inefficiency of bubble sorts makes a proof of its correctness interesting. 2 Algorithm. Let an element in a list be considered out of order if it is followed in the list by another value strictly smaller than itself. WebTable 1: Web-based popularity of sorts. The good news is that Quicksort is by far the most-referenced sort on the web. The bad news is that bubble sort is the second or third most popular sort and is by far the most cited O(n 2) sort. 5 Hopefully the situation is somewhat mitigated by the greater rate of increase in hits for selection sort compared to bubble sort.

WebBubble Sort's proof of correctness is the same as for Selection Sort. It first finds the smallest element and swaps it down into array entry 0. Then finds the second smallest … WebThere are two interesting things to know about bubble sorts. First, large values are always sorted first. If you run through it again (if you are insane), you'll notice that the 9 then the 7 then the 5 and so on get sorted first. Knowing this, we could make the code slightly smarter and stop repeatedly iterating over already sorted values.

Bub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ing the current element with the one after it, swapping their values if needed. These passes through the list are repeated until no swaps had to be performed during a pass, meaning that the list has become fully sorted. The algorithm, which is a comparison …

Web7. The speed of any particular sorting algorithm depends on a few different factors such as input order and key distribution. In many cases bubble sort is pretty slow, but there are some conditions under which it's very fast. There's a great sorting algorithm comparison animation at this site: homedics 800 numberWebBubble Sort Pseudocode. Bubble sort is a simple algorithm — the pseudocode for it is also pretty simple and short. Have a look and use it to write your code in a programming language of your choice. bubbleSort( array, size) for i ← 0 to size - 2 for j ← 0 to size - 2 - i If array [ j] and array [ j + 1] are not in the correct order Swap ... homedics 5 in 1 uv air purifierWebIn Bubble sort in C, we compare two adjacent elements of an array to find which one is greater or lesser and swap them based on the given condition, whether ascending or descending, until the final place of the element is not found. We repeat this until no more swaps are required, and all the elements get sorted. Bubble sort gets its name from ... homedics 5-in-1 tower air purifierWebA bucket sort can do this. 1. Set up a series of empty buckets. 2. Put the data into the correct buckets. 3. Buckets that have more than one item of data in them will be sorted … homedics 600WebNov 24, 2013 · Bubble sort is a specific case, and its full complexity is (n*(n-1)) - which gives you the correct number: 5 elements leads to 5*(5-1) operations, which is 20, and is what you found in the worst case.. The simplified Big O notation, however, removes the constants and the least significantly growing terms, and just gives O(n^2).This makes it … homedics 98829WebApr 11, 2024 · Algoritma Bubble Sort merupakan proses pengurutan yang secara berangsur-angsur memindahkan data ke posisi yang tepat. Karena itulah, algoritma ini dinamakan “bubble” atau yang jika diterjemahkan ke dalam Bahasa Indonesia, artinya yaitu gelembung. Fungsi algoritma ini adalah untuk mengurutkan data dari yang terkecil ke … homedics 800 led digital scaleWebWhat is Sorting in C++: Bubble Sort, Insertion Sort & More Simplilearn Top 45 RPA Interview Questions and Answers for 2024 - Simplilearn - Dec 07 2014 Top 45 RPA Interview Questions and Answers for 2024 Simplilearn Google Pixel 6a: 9 tips and tricks to try now - Android Police - Dec 14 2024 homedics 5 in one air purifier